Quick Setup Guide BTP2265HW Self-Propelled Mower Quick-switch 3-in-1 Convert from mulching to bagging to side-discharge: Read the manuals that came with your mower for: Important safety warnings Further explanation of features Operating instructions Problem? Call 1-800-743-4115 Unpack the mower A Cut all four corners of the box from top to bottom. B Remove all items from around the mower. Remove the clear plastic sheet from the top of the engine. C Remove the grass catcher from its plastic shipping bag. Assemble the handle A Remove the knob, lock washer, and bolt from each side of the handle base. B Loosen, but do not remove, the knobs on the handle. Remove the cardboard slats. C Lift the handle to the operating position, and tighten the upper knobs. D Reinsert the lower handle bolts through the handle base and handle (most users will prefer the middle position). Install the lock washers and fully tighten the knobs. Set up the recoil rope handle A Hold the bail control against the handle, and pull the recoil rope handle out to the rope guide on the handle. Hook the recoil rope into the rope guide (it might be a tight fit). Add oil and fuel A Move the mower outside to a flat, level surface. B Remove the oil fill cap. Add the entire contents of the supplied oil container to the engine. Replace the oil fill cap. IMPORTANT Mower is shipped without oil in engine. Failure to add oil will result in engine damage. C Remove the fuel fill cap. Add clean, fresh, UNLEADED fuel with a minimum of 87 octane, leaving one inch of space from the top of the tank for fuel expansion. IMPORTANT Fuel tank holds less than 1/2 gallon. IMPORTANT DO NOT mix oil with fuel. D Replace the fuel fill cap, and wipe up any spills. Read the operator’s manual for operating, maintenance, and safety instructions Start the mower A Move all four wheels to the desired cutting height, and set the mower to mulch, discharge or bag. (See Quick-switch 3-in-1 instructions below.) B Hold the bail control against the handle. C Pull the recoil rope handle until the engine starts. D To engage the drive system, move the drive lever all the way forward. E To stop the drive system, release the bail control. F To stop the engine and blade, release the bail control. BTP2265HW Overview Items that you will need Unleaded Fuel (minimum 87 octane) Utility Knife Items Included Failure to read and follow instructions in the operator's manual could result in death and/or bodily injury. Running engines give off carbon monoxide, an odorless, colorless, poison gas. Breathing carbon monoxide can cause nausea, fainting, or death. Operate this product ONLY outdoors. Keep exhaust gas from entering a confined area through windows, doors, ventilation intakes or other openings. DO NOT operate this product inside any building or enclosure, even if windows and doors are open. 1 2 3 4 5 6 1 For mulching, leave the mulching cover in place. 2 To convert to bagging: A Lift the rear door. B Holding the rear door open, attach the grass catcher to the rear of the mower. C Make sure the hooks on either side of the catcher frame hook onto the rear door rod. D Release the rear door (it will lay on top of the grass catcher). 3 To convert to side-discharge: A Lift the mulching cover. B Install the side discharge deflector onto the mower deck. Make sure the upper tabs of the deflector are hooked behind the mulching cover rod, and the deck tabs stick up through the locking slots. C Release the mulching cover (it will lay on top of the side discharge deflector).
